Professional Background

Dr. Peterson is an Assistant Professor in the Department of Radiology at the University of Kansas Medical Center. She specializes in breast imaging, including screening mammography, contrast-enhanced mammography, breast ultrasound, breast MRI, and breast biopsy and localization procedures.

Dr. Peterson received her medical degree from the University of Kansas School of Medicine. She also completed Diagnostic Radiology residency and Breast Imaging fellowship at the University of Kansas School of Medicine. After fellowship, she served as an Assistant Professor in Breast andamp; Women’s Imaging at Prentice Women’s Hospital, Northwestern University in Chicago, IL before to returning to Kansas City. Her research interests include high-risk screening and breast MRI.
